NASCAR WCUP: Mark Martin, Pontiac Excitement 400 Post Race Quotes
17 May 1999
MARK MARTIN: 6- Valvoline Taurus -- "Our car handled excellent tonight, but I felt we did a very poor job in Texas with managing the tire problems that they had there and became a victim. I didn't want to be a victim tonight at any cost, so we made sure that we did the best we could with that and let it all hang out at the end. We just weren't good enough to beat the 88." WHAT WAS HAPPENING WITH THE TIRES? "The tires were blistering. The sealer was getting such a bite on those tires. We came up and tested with the Busch car and we saw that with the Busch cars in the test. Burton and I both did that. If your car wasn't handling really perfect, it would abuse one particular tire. If it was pushing, it would obviously abuse the right-front and have it blister and go down. It was a case of the sealer having so much grip versus not having the sealer on. That sealer is awesome. "It's always something -- air pressure, camber, whatever. These cars are made to race. We have to race 'em hard, we have to run 'em hard, you have to run the air pressure low, you have to run a lot of camber. That's not what hurt the tires. What hurt the tires was the tire was designed for the race track without this sealer on it and the sealer was so good this time that it actually put a lot more heat than normal into the tires."Editors Note: For hundreds of hot racing photos and racing art, be sure to visit The Racing ImageGalleries and the Visions of Speed Art Gallery.
